The Society is governed by its Constitution, which was ratified in May 2004. The Society is listed with the Charity Commission for England and Wales as Registered Charity No. 1104496.

Members of the W. H. Auden Society are sent its publications, which at present consist of a semi-annual Newsletter containing essays, reviews, announcements, notes and queries about W. H. Auden and his work. Publishers and theatres sometimes offer members of the Society slight discounts on books and performances. The term of membership is one year. Fees are as follows:

Individual members:  £ 9 $ 15 € 15  
Student members:   £ 5 $ 8 € 8  
Institutions:     £ 18 $ 30 € 30  

The W. H. Auden Society is regist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ales, and is registered as a not-for-profit corporation in the State of New York.
